68.5% of the people in Columbus are religious:
- 4.8% are Baptist
- 0.0% are Episcopalian
- 11.0% are Catholic
- 46.8% are Lutheran
- 2.4% are Methodist
- 3.3% are Pentecostal
- 0.2% are Presbyterian
- 0.0% are Church of Jesus Christ
- 0.0% are another Christian faith
- 0.0% are Judaism
- 0.0% are an eastern faith
- 0.0% affilitates with Islam
